WebbMigrant workers are more vulnerable to violations of their fundamental rights, concerning forced labour, child labour, non-discrimination and equal treatment and freedom of association and collective bargaining and are more likely to work excessive hours, under unsafe conditions and be paid less than the legal minimum.
